The History of the Phillie Phanatic
Before we dive into the exciting reveal of who plays the Phillie Phanatic, let’s take a quick trip down memory lane to explore the origins of this quirky green creature. The Phillie Phanatic made its grand debut on April 25, 1978, during a game at Veteran’s Stadium. Created by Harrison/Erickson, a New York-based design firm, the Phanatic quickly became a fan favorite with its unique appearance and playful antics.
Over the years, the Phillie Phanatic has become an integral part of the Phillies’ identity, entertaining fans of all ages with its hilarious dances, comedic skits, and interactions with players and spectators. Whether sliding down a giant inflatable slide or engaging in a dance-off with the grounds crew, the Phanatic never fails to bring smiles and laughter to the ballpark.

Frequently Asked Questions
Who is the performer behind the Phillie Phanatic character?
The Phillie Phanatic is portrayed by a team of performers, with one main performer taking the lead role. The current lead performer of the Phillie Phanatic is Tom Burgoyne, who has been entertaining Philadelphia Phillies fans in this iconic role since 1988.
How long has the current performer been playing the Phillie Phanatic?
Tom Burgoyne, the current lead performer of the Phillie Phanatic, has been embodying the character since 1988. With over three decades of experience, he has become synonymous with the lovable green mascot of the Philadelphia Phillies.
Are there other performers who also play the Phillie Phanatic?
While Tom Burgoyne is the main performer behind the Phillie Phanatic, there is also a team of backup performers who help bring the character to life. These performers undergo rigorous training to ensure consistency in portraying the Phillie Phanatic’s playful and energetic personality.
